Output 3408ed35deb84d20c9035c51586ed15ea38ab70aed84b885c23d7ca0c79e6043:0

value
1551521248
script pubkey
OP_0 OP_PUSHBYTES_20 358e6e774fb17a0a85b24629c6f986c0634d55ba
address
ltc1qxk8xua60k9aq4pdjgc5ud7vxcp3564d63d90e2
transaction
3408ed35deb84d20c9035c51586ed15ea38ab70aed84b885c23d7ca0c79e6043
spent
true